    Google appeals landmark antitrust verdict over search monopoly

    Google has appealed a US district choose’s landmark antitrust ruling that discovered the corporate illegally held a monopoly in on-line search.

    “As now we have lengthy mentioned, the Courtroom’s August 2024 ruling ignored the fact that folks use Google as a result of they need to, not as a result of they’re pressured to,” Google’s vp for regulatory affairs Lee-Anne Mulholland mentioned.

    In its announcement on Friday, Google mentioned the ruling by Choose Amit Mehta did not account for the tempo of innovation and intense competitors the corporate faces.

    The corporate is requesting a pause on implementing a collection of fixes – seen by some observers as too lenient – geared toward limiting its monopoly energy.

    Choose Mehta acknowledged the speedy adjustments to the Google’s enterprise when he issued his cures in September, writing that the emergence of generative synthetic intelligence (AI) had modified the course of the case.

    He refused to grant authorities attorneys their request for a Google breakup that would come with a spin-off of Chrome, the world’s hottest browser.

    As a substitute, he pushed much less rigorous cures, together with a requirement that Google share sure information with “certified opponents” as deemed by the courtroom.

    That information was as a consequence of embody parts of its search index, Google’s large stock of internet content material that features like a map of the web.

    The choose additionally referred to as for Google to permit sure opponents to show the tech big’s search outcomes as their very own in a bid to provide upstarts the time and sources they should innovate.

    On Friday, Mulholland balked at being pressured to share search information and syndication companies with rivals as she justified the request for a halt to implementing the orders.

    “These mandates would threat Individuals’ privateness and discourage opponents from constructing their very own merchandise — in the end stifling the innovation that retains the U.S. on the forefront of worldwide expertise,” Mulholland wrote.

    Whereas the corporate has invested rising sums of money into AI, these ambitions have come below scrutiny.

    Final month, the EU opened an investigation into Google over its AI summaries which seem above search outcomes.

    The European Fee mentioned it will probe whether or not Google used information from web sites to supply the service and failed to supply applicable compensation to publishers.

    Google mentioned the investigation risked stifling innovation in a aggressive market.

    This week, Google mother or father Alphabet turned the fourth firm ever to achieve a market capitalisation of $4tn.
